Barred Owl Hunting Baby Robins by Kaj Bune

At dusk the other day I drove by a barred owl perched on a wire. I quickly parked, jumped out and stood beneath it. Just after shooting the wire photos, it leaped into the hedge below and immediately flew out across the street to a perch in a tree. Because it was being harassed by multiple robins, I can only conclude that it was raiding a robin nest. It didn’t make a kill this time, but I wonder what has happened since. Were the adult robins able to fend off subsequent attacks?
